MTN Nigeria plans tower contract revisions, eyes green energy

ABUJA - MTN Nigeria’s leadership, at a recent Capital Markets Day (CMD) event in Abuja, outlined strategic plans for the company's future, focusing on revising tower contracts and embracing green energy initiatives. CEO Karl Toriola and CFO Modupe Kadri engaged with investors and government officials, discussing the reallocation of tower assets and the broader 'Ambition 2025' Strategy.

Toriola announced that MTN Nigeria would regularly review its tower contracts to enhance vendor efficiency and optimize operational performance. This move is part of a broader strategy to maintain robust broadband development while managing foreign exchange volatility and rising energy costs. The company is also placing a strong emphasis on cost-effectiveness in its expansion efforts, particularly through the use of green energy solutions.

During the CMD held on Tuesday and Wednesday, Toriola detailed the shift in site ownership from IHS Towers to American Tower (NYSE:AMT) Corporation (ATC). ATC's stake is poised to grow from 13% to 26% after acquiring sites from IHS, whose contracts are set to expire between 2024 and 2029. The changeover comes after competitive bidding that saw IHS, currently holding a significant 60% share, lose sites to ATC due to governance issues.

Kadri highlighted the importance of energy efficiency in MTN's expense management strategy. He pointed out that Independent Power Producers (IPPs) play a crucial role in this approach amid challenges posed by forex liberalization. Both Toriola and Kadri emphasized the company's commitment to enhancing connectivity and fostering financial inclusion across Nigeria.

The CMD event also served as a platform for dialogue on macroeconomic reforms in Nigeria, with discussions centering around private sector investment's role in unlocking the country's growth potential. Toriola took this opportunity to showcase MTN's achievements under its 'Ambition 2025' Strategy and the bright prospects for Nigeria's digital economy within these liberal economic reforms.

MTN Nigeria continues to focus on strategic initiatives that align with the nation’s economic policies while pursuing growth in the digital space and improving its service efficiency for customers nationwide.
